What Are the Set-up Costs for a Nevis Trust?

Understanding the Benefits of a Nevis Trust

Regardless of your financial situation or country of residence, you likely aim to reduce tax liabilities and secure your assets. Establishing a Nevis Trust can help you achieve these goals. Governed by the laws of Nevis, a Caribbean jurisdiction, this type of trust offers many advantages, including asset protection and financial privacy.

Why Consider a Nevis Trust?

Nevis has earned a strong reputation as a top jurisdiction for asset protection. It attracts individuals looking to shield their wealth from creditors, lawsuits, and other potential legal threats. A Nevis Trust offers several key benefits:

  • Privacy: The terms, assets, and beneficiaries of a Nevis Trust remain confidential and are not publicly disclosed.
  • Tax Planning: Benefit from a favorable tax environment with no income, capital gains, or estate tax.
  • Asset Protection: Assets held in a Nevis Trust are hard for creditors to reach, even in the event of a judgment.
  • Flexibility: Can be tailored to your specific needs, allowing you to customize asset distribution and management.

The Set-up Costs of a Nevis Trust

The cost of setting up a Nevis Trust depends on factors such as the complexity of the trust, the types of assets involved, and the services required. Here’s a breakdown of typical costs:

  • Initial Set-up Fees: The minimum cost to establish it is around $4,000. On average, the cost ranges between $5,000 and $10,000, including legal fees and necessary documentation.
  • Annual Maintenance Fees: Managing it typically incurs yearly fees between $1,000 and $5,000. These fees cover trust administration, compliance, and ongoing asset management.

Additional Expenses

Additional costs may apply for services such as investment management, legal consultations, or accounting. This is especially relevant if the trust holds multiple offshore entities or assets in locations like Switzerland or the Cayman Islands.
